II. The Role of Astronomy in Mayan Society
Astronomy was not merely a scientific pursuit for the Maya; it was deeply intertwined with their daily existence and cultural practices. Here are some key roles that astronomy played in Mayan society:
- Daily Life and Agricultural Practices: The Maya relied on celestial observations to determine the optimal times for planting and harvesting crops. The rising and setting of specific stars and planets indicated seasonal changes, enabling farmers to synchronize their agricultural activities with nature.
- Religious Ceremonies and Calendrical Systems: Many religious rituals were based on astronomical events. The Maya created intricate calendars that aligned with celestial phenomena, allowing them to celebrate significant events in harmony with the cosmos.
- Architecture and Urban Planning: Mayan cities were often aligned with celestial events. Structures like pyramids and temples were constructed to mark solstices, equinoxes, and other astronomical occurrences, demonstrating a sophisticated understanding of the relationship between the earth and the heavens.
III. The Mayan Calendar: A Complex System
The Mayan calendar is a testament to the civilization’s advanced astronomical knowledge. It consists of several interrelated cycles, primarily the Long Count, Tzolk’in, and Haab’ calendars. Each of these calendars served distinct purposes:
- Long Count: This calendar tracked longer periods and was used for historical and astronomical events, allowing the Maya to maintain records over centuries.
- Tzolk’in: A 260-day ritual calendar that combined 20 day names with 13 numbers, it was essential for religious ceremonies and agricultural activities.
- Haab’: A 365-day solar calendar that aligned with the solar year, it was used for civil purposes and agricultural planning.

VI. Observational Techniques: Tools of the Maya
The Maya developed sophisticated observational techniques and instruments that contributed to their astronomical knowledge:
- Instruments and Methods Used: They utilized tools such as the gnomon (a vertical pole) to track the sun’s shadow and measure time, as well as observatories built to align with celestial events.
- Contributions to Mathematics and Geometry: The Maya made significant advancements in mathematics, including the concept of zero, which was crucial for their astronomical calculations.
